Market Dynamics and Industry Classification of Japan Low Chlorine Epoxy Resin Market

The Japanese low chlorine epoxy resin market is positioned within the specialty chemicals and advanced materials industry, characterized by high innovation intensity and stringent environmental standards. It is classified as a growth segment within the broader epoxy resin industry, which is experiencing a transition from traditional formulations to eco-friendly variants. The market primarily serves sectors such as electronics, automotive, aerospace, and infrastructure, where durability and environmental compliance are critical.

Japan’s market is distinguished by its maturity, with a well-established supply chain, advanced manufacturing capabilities, and a strong emphasis on R&D. The industry’s evolution is driven by regulatory pressures to reduce chlorinated compounds, pushing manufacturers toward sustainable alternatives. The market scope is predominantly regional, focusing on Japan’s domestic demand, but with increasing export potential to Asia-Pacific and global markets. Stakeholders include chemical producers, end-user OEMs, research institutions, and policymakers committed to environmental sustainability and technological innovation.

Dynamic Market Research Perspective: PESTLE Analysis of Japan Low Chlorine Epoxy Resin Market

The PESTLE framework reveals that Japan’s low chlorine epoxy resin industry is heavily influenced by political and regulatory factors emphasizing environmental protection. Stringent policies on chemical emissions and waste management incentivize innovation in low-impact formulations. Economically, Japan’s stable industrial base and high R&D expenditure underpin technological advancements, though global supply chain disruptions pose risks.

Social trends favor eco-conscious consumption, prompting manufacturers to develop greener products. Technological progress in bio-based resins and process optimization enhances competitiveness. Legal frameworks enforce compliance standards, fostering innovation but also increasing operational costs. Environmental concerns about chlorinated compounds drive demand for sustainable alternatives, while geopolitical factors influence trade dynamics and raw material sourcing. Overall, the industry’s trajectory is shaped by a complex interplay of policy, innovation, and societal expectations.
